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Extraction

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Be aware of these common signs and take action quickly to prevent further damage.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your attic can show hidden moisture and mold growth. Don’t ignore these odors, as they can compromise your home’s structural integrity and pose serious health risks.

Water Stains and Discoloration

Visible water stains and discoloration on your attic’s ceiling or walls can show water damage. Address these issues qu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Warped or Buckled Roofing

Warped or buckled roofing can compromise your attic’s integrity and allow water to seep in. Don’t wait to address these issues, as they can lead to costly repairs and health risks.

Unusual Sounds or Squeaks

Unusual sounds or squeaks coming from your attic can show hidden damage or structural issues. Don’t ignore these sounds, as they can compromise your home’s safety and security.

Visible Puddles or Leaks

Visible puddles or leaks in your attic can show water damage or a compromised roof. Address these issues qu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Unpleasant Mold or Mildew

Unpleasant mold or mildew growth in your attic can compromise your home’s structural integrity and pose serious health risks. Don’t ignore these issues, as they can lead to costly repairs and health problems.

Attic Water Extraction Cost in Oak Harbor, WA

The cost of attic water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Oak Harbor, WA. Our estimates are free and based on a thorough assessment of your attic.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Insulation removal and replacement $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, type of insulation, and local labor costs
Roofing repair or replacement $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of roofing material, and local labor costs
Mold remediation and prevention $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of mold, and local labor costs
Attic restoration and rep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of repairs, and local labor costs
Free estimate and consultation $0 – $100 Size of affected area and local conditions

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and consultations to ensure you get the best possible solution for your attic water damage.

Common Questions About Attic Water Extraction

What is attic water extraction?

Attic water extraction is the process of removing water from your attic, including standing water, moisture, and humidity. Our team uses specialized equipment to safely and efficiently extract water and dry out your attic.

How long does attic water extraction take?

The length of time it takes to complete attic water extraction dep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will work with you to develop a customized plan to ensure your attic is safe and secure as quickly as possible.

Is attic water extraction covered by insurance?

Attic water extraction may be covered by your insurance policy, depending on the cause of the damage and your coverage. Our team will work with you to navigate the insurance process and ensure you get the coverage you deserve.

Can I do attic water extraction myself?

No, it’s not recommended to try attic water extraction yourself. Water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ely and efficiently extract water and prevent further damage. Our team is IICRC certified and equipped to handle even the most complex water extraction jobs.

How can I prevent attic water damage?

Preventing attic water damage needs regular maintenance and inspections. Our team recommends checking your attic for signs of water damage, ensuring proper ventilation, and addressing any issues quickly to prevent further damage.
